site stats

Preemptoff

WebSingle thread tracing. function graph tracer. dynamic ftrace. Selecting function filters via index. Dynamic ftrace with the function graph tracer. ftrace_enabled. Filter commands. trace_pipe. trace entries. WebThese are the latency tracers, since the latency tracers have a separate internal buffer. The plugin option is therefore only necessary for the wakeup, wakeup-rt, irqsoff, preemptoff …

- The Go Programming Language

WebJul 16, 2008 · The Tracers ----------- Here is the list of current tracers that may be configured. ftrace - function tracer that uses mcount to trace all functions. sched_switch - traces the … WebAdd preempt off timings. A lot of kernel core code is taken from the RT patch latency trace that was written by Ingo Molnar. jcpenney specials today https://aladinsuper.com

[PATCH 1/2] lib: Add module for testing preemptoff/irqsoff latency …

WebTracers usually do more than just trace an event. Common tracers are: function, function_graph, preemptirqsoff, irqsoff, preemptoff and wakeup. A tracer must be … WebLinux kernel source tree. Contribute to torvalds/linux development by creating an account on GitHub. Web[v9,6/7] lib: Add module to simulate atomic sections for testing preemptoff tracers Message ID [email protected] ( mailing list archive ) lsn fish finder

Ftrace: Latency Tracing

Category:ftrace-爱代码爱编程

Tags:Preemptoff

Preemptoff

Linux Tracing Technologies — The Linux Kernel documentation

Web-P --preemptoff Preempt off tracing (used with -b)-q --quiet print only a summary on exit-Q --priospread spread priority levels starting at specified value-r --relative use relative timer … WebApr 13, 2024 · preemptoff:不等于空字符串的话,保持 curg 在这个 m 上运行。 P: status:P 的运行状态。 schedtick:P 的调度次数。 syscalltick:P 的系统调用次数。 m:隶属哪一个 M。 runqsize:运行队列中的 G 数量。 gfreecnt:可用的 G(状态为 Gdead)。 G: status:G 的运行状态。

Preemptoff

Did you know?

WebOct 6, 2024 · are enabled when the architecture supports the corresponding feature. Do not confuse them with the listed options. The features are only enabled when the listed configuration options are enabled and not when only the HAVE options are.. Function tracer uses -pg option of gcc to have every function in the kernel call a special function … WebSpecify a trace plugin. Plugins are special Ftrace tracers that usually do more than just trace an event. Common plugins are function, function_graph, preemptirqsoff, irqsoff, …

WebThese are the latency tracers, since the latency tracers have a separate internal buffer. The plugin option is therefore only necessary for the wakeup, wakeup-rt, irqsoff, preemptoff and preemptirqsoff plugins. With out this option, the extract command will extract from the internal Ftrace buffers.-O option WebFor the preemptoff tracer: echo preemptoff > /d/tracing/current_tracer sleep 1 insmod ./test_atomic_sections.ko atomic_mode=preempt atomic_time=500000 sleep 1 bash-4.3# …

Weblinux内核内存管理-写时复制. 深入了解使用linux查看磁盘io使用情况. 除了CFS调度器之外,还包括重要的实时调度器,有两种RR和FIFO调度策略。. 本章只是一个简单的介绍。. 1. 抢占内核. 如果Linux内核不支持抢占,那么进程要么主动要求调度,如schedule ()或者cond ... WebNov 29, 2015 · GOTRACEBACK=1 is the default behaviour, stack traces for all goroutines are shown, but stack frames related to the runtime are suppressed. GOTRACEBACK=2 is the …

Web*Re: [4.4-rt PATCH] trace: use rcuidle version for preemptoff_hist trace point 2016-02-23 21:23 [4.4-rt PATCH] trace: use rcuidle version for preemptoff_hist trace point Yang Shi @ …

WebThe Debugfs Officially mounted at – /sys/kernel/debug I prefer – mkdir /debug – mount -t debugfs nodev /debug – This presentation will use /debug Do what you want jcpenney south portland maineWebSynchronous safe-points occur when a running goroutine checks 14 // for a preemption request. 15 // 16 // 3. Asynchronous safe-points occur at any instruction in user code 17 // where the goroutine can be safely paused and a conservative 18 // stack and register scan can find stack roots. The runtime can 19 // stop a goroutine at an async safe ... jcpenney spectrum mallWebDec 6, 2024 · The tracer used by the blktrace user application. hwlat - The Hardware Latency tracer is used to detect if the hardware produces any latency. irqsoff - Traces the areas … jcpenney special occasion dresses for womenj.c. penneys phone numberWebDefined in 1 files as a prototype: kernel/trace/trace.h, line 746 (as a prototype) Defined in 1 files as a function: kernel/trace/trace_selftest.c, line 972 (as a ... jcpenney spencer iaWebMar 29, 2024 · 6.3 用 GODEBUG 看调度跟踪. 0. 0. 0. 让 Go 更强大的原因之一莫过于它的 GODEBUG 工具,GODEBUG 的设置可以让 Go 程序在运行时输出调试信息,可以根据你的要求很直观的看到你想要的调度器或垃圾回收等详细信息,并且还不需要加装其它的插件,非常方便,在本章节我们 ... jcpenney southpark hoursWebJun 30, 2015 · Hi people, I noticed in a kernel 4.0.7 that I loose CAN packets when an incoming rsync transfer changes my eMMC or SD-Card image. I used CONFIG_FRACE to find why this is the case, and came to this trace: # tracer: preemptoff # # preemptoff latency trace v1.1.5 on 4.0.7 # --------------------------... lsn football schedule